Caring for Your New Arrival

Baby Basics
 
This popular class is designed to answer your questions about basic newborn care. Bathing, diapering, nutritional needs, safety issues, when to call the doctor, normal newborn behavior and how to prepare for those first weeks of parenting are among the topics discussed. It is suggested that this class be taken by the six month of pregnancy.

Infant CPR and Safety
This is an essential class for all new parents and caregivers. Choking rescue, c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) for the first year of life, as well as other important safety issues, will be covered. Discussion, video and hands-on practice are included. It is suggested that this class be taken by the six month of pregnancy
